The rains the Valley received toward the end of November definitely helped ease the local drought situation as most the region is currently in the clear.
However, the rain did little to help Falcon and Amistad Reservoirs as their combined level continues to hover at just over 30 percent of capacity. Falcon, in particular, is at a perilously low 14.1 percent full.
Keep in mind that if the combined level of our reservoirs falls below 25 percent, per City
ordinance, Stage 2 Mandatory Water Conservation restrictions will once again be initiated as they were this past summer.
